  • The Internet of Things (IoT) is a breakthrough in the very popular IT field. Lots of equipment that has implemented IoT, especially household appliances. IoT itself has technology that can make human work easier, namely the Wireless Sensor Network (WSN). Wireless sensor network is a wireless network that has many interconnected nodes. Nodes - these nodes can communicate with each other. There are 2 communication processes, namely pull and push. The communication process that is commonly used is pull, but pull has a disadvantage for some wireless sensor network architectures. In this study the communication process of the push message will be implemented using the Message Queuing Telemetry Transport protocol. This protocol can be applied to the wireless sensor because the nodes in the wireless sensor have few sources. Sending data from the sensor node to the sink node is managed by the broker to send data to the sink node. This makes the sensor node work lighter and more efficient
